Let `F_1` be the set of parallelograms , `F_2` the set of rectangles, `F_3` the set of rhombuses , `F_4` the set of squares and `F_5` the set of trapeziums in a plane. Then `F_1` may be equal to :

A

`F_2 nn F_3`

B

`F_3 nn F_4`

C

`F_2 uu F_5`

D

`F_2 uu F_3 uu F_4 uu F_5`

Text Solution

Verified by Experts

The correct Answer is:
D
